Former Meta working chief Sheryl Sandberg is leaving the corporate’s board of administrators.
“With a heart filled with gratitude and a mind filled with memories, I let the Meta board know that I will not stand for reelection this May,” Sandberg wrote in a Facebook publish on Wednesday.
Sandberg, 54, joined Facebook in 2008 as Mark Zuckerberg’s prime deputy after spending about seven years at Google. In 2012, she grew to become a board member on the firm. During her tenure, Facebook rose from a highflying startup to grow to be probably the most useful firms on the earth, topping a $1 trillion market cap at its peak in 2021.
Sandberg introduced her departure from Meta in mid-2022, following a number of controversies that dogged the corporate and sullied its status amongst customers, lawmakers and buyers. Most notably, Facebook was central to the unfold of disinformation forward of the 2016 election and throughout the early days of the Covid pandemic in 2020. The firm has additionally been within the topic of antitrust investigations and was scrutinized in Sandberg’s waning days for its inadequate efforts to fight hate on its platform.
When Sandberg stepped down as Meta COO in June 2022, she was changed by Javier Olivan, who had been serving as Meta’s chief progress officer.
Since leaving Meta, Sandberg has devoted a lot of her time on her LeanIn.org nonprofit, which focuses on empowering ladies tin the office, and associated tasks.
“I wanted my new chapter to be able to really make a difference,” Sandberg instructed CNBC Make It in August. “We’ve been in development on this since I was at Meta, but being able to have the time to put into [this launch] and to really be … a bigger part of this has meant a lot to me.”
